Problem

Conventional anion perfume machines suffer from unsmooth air output due to water droplets causing noise and vibration, leading to heat issues and potential machine breakdown, as well as low-frequency vibration sounds that disrupt sleep quality.

Innovation Solution

An anion perfume machine featuring a soft silicone water blocking sheet with a cross body and claws to divert water drops and generate inclined vibration waves, optimizing atomization and reducing noise and vibration, while a throttling and shock absorption mechanism ensures efficient smoke guidance and prevents overheating.

AI summary

An anion perfume machine in which a throttling and shock absorption water blocking sheet and oscillator generating inclined vibration waves are configured, wherein the water blocking sheet is made of soft silicone material and assuming a cross body with four claws, a round petal is adapted to connect the two adjacent claws to each other, a center of the cross body configured with a barbed hook is exactly in engagement with a through hole of a cross rib configured on a center of a throttle cover; an inclined vibration guide unit is lodged in a oscillator accommodation room configured on a bottom of a vibration wave conduction cup; the oscillation unit is constituted by a silicone seat, thereby generating inclined vibration waves, allowing a large number of upward inclined atomized spouts to be sprayed on the essence oil water cup and flow upward along a wall of a cup.
